News summary

In a thrilling Championship match, Leeds United secured a 2-1 victory over Sunderland with a stoppage-time header from Pascal Struijk, marking his second goal of the match after equalizing earlier. Sunderland had taken the lead with Wilson Isidor's goal in the first half, but Leeds extended their unbeaten run to 15 matches and reclaimed the top spot in the league, now 10 points clear of Sunderland. Despite Leeds dominating possession, they struggled against a well-organized Sunderland defense, with goalkeeper Illan Meslier making crucial saves early in the game. The match featured two penalty appeals from Leeds that were denied, showcasing their determination to clinch a late winner. This victory also halted Sunderland's eight-match unbeaten run, leaving them fourth in the standings. The result further solidifies Leeds' position as a strong contender for promotion this season.
